Probe TS/TSR ... ZG1
for aerodynamic analysis
Attributes:
- for aerodynamic analysis - with connection cable
- compared to cylindrical probes ZS, TS and TSR probes offer a significantly lower sensivity to indirect oncoming flow, so that they can be used when the direction of flow is not known
- TSR probes are able to sense the +/-direction of flow appropriately signed
- sensor material: stainless steel. Working temperature range up to +125 / +260 °C
- suitable for fixed and portable measuring of flow velocity v [m/s] in clean gases, briefly in particulate-laden gases
- signal evaluation with hand-held unit HFA, transducer UFA and system units

MiniAir 6
vane anemometer with voltage output
Attributes:
- the self-contained anemometer probe MiniAir6 measures the velocity of gaseous media, directly giving out a linear voltage signal
- the MiniAir6 like other MiniAir models features the unique Snap Head, providing on-site serviceability, thus making it ideal for continual measuring
- in anemometry, the accuracy achieved by a vane probe is acknowledged to be unmatched
- the vane rotation is closely linear to flow velocity and is unaffected by pressure, temperature, density and humidity
- output signal 0 - 2,0 V
